Noirmoutier
The island of Noirmoutier has long been famous for the Passage du Gois, the submersible road that can only be navigated at low tide. Come and discover its salt marshes, sandy beaches and rocky shores, fishing ports and marinas, not forgetting the oysters and shellfish…
This peninsula, accessible via a bridge, offers beautiful walks to the Bois de la Chaise or the Jacobsen Bay bird sanctuary…
Yeu Island
Ile d’Yeu, accessible only by boat from the mainland, is a wild and unspoilt piece of land 17 km from the coast.
Cycling is king here, and the small, cove-shaped beaches are the real beauty. The sea air is 100% guaranteed, and its harbor and restaurants are sure to delight you during your daily getaway …
